How to ask the right questions (and avoid the wrong ones)
The quality of your survey depends on your questions—but writing great questions is tough. We’ve all seen examples like:
Bad: “Do you study a lot at home?” (What does “a lot” even mean?)
Good: “On average, how many hours per week do you spend studying outside of class?”
Specific’s AI survey generator designs questions that drive genuine insight and avoid bias. It knows how to skip vague wording and home in on actionable details. Want to sharpen your own survey-writing skills? Focus on:
Being concrete (“How often do you use a planner for assignments?” instead of “Are you organized?”)
Keeping language relevant for freshmen, not grad students
Following up on “why” and “how”—where the best learnings often are
